How Sir David Beckham’s Children Reacted to His Knighthood

When Sir David Beckham received his knighthood, it wasn’t just the football world that took notice—his family was equally intrigued. Beckham revealed in a recent interview that his children were curious about what “extra privileges” they might gain from their father’s new status. His children—Brooklyn, Romeo, Cruz, and Harper—have already enjoyed a privileged lifestyle, but they still wanted to know if the knighthood came with additional perks.

Beckham humorously recounted their questions, saying, “My kids turned around to me and said, ‘Dad, do we get any privileges like, any more?’ I was like, well, apart from the ones that you’ve already got. Absolutely not.” This lighthearted exchange highlights the close and playful relationship Beckham shares with his children, who are well aware of their father’s achievements but remain grounded.

Despite the curiosity, Beckham admitted that the knighthood did not change much in their day-to-day lives. He joked about not having to change his bank card or passport and said the only tangible difference was the personalized notepaper he now uses for thank-you letters. This modesty reflects Beckham’s humble approach to the honor, focusing more on its symbolic value than on any material benefits.

The Emotional Significance of the Knighthood for Beckham and His Family

For Sir David Beckham, the day he was knighted at Windsor Castle was one of the most memorable moments of his life. He described it as “probably the best day of my life,” ranking it alongside the births of his children and his marriage to Victoria Beckham. The ceremony was made even more special by the presence of his wife, parents, and children, who all gathered to celebrate this milestone.

Beckham shared that having his loved ones by his side helped ease his nerves during the ceremony. He fondly joked that his children could now call him “Sir Dad,” a playful nod to his new title. The emotional weight of the occasion was evident, as Beckham reflected on the honor as a family celebration and a recognition of his lifelong dedication to football and philanthropy.
